An In-Depth Look at the Itinerary

Early Morning Pickup & Departure

The day begins bright and early at 8:00 am, with a pickup from your hotel arranged by the tour operator. This makes it easier to avoid the hassle of finding your way to An Thoi Port, which is the starting point for the boat journey. The round-trip shuttle service around Tran Hung Dao street ensures you’re transported comfortably and on time, setting a relaxed tone for the day ahead.

First Stop: Phu Quoc Island for Fishing

At 8:30 am, the tour kicks off with a 30-minute fishing activity on Phu Quoc Island itself. While this is a quick introduction, it’s a chance to test your angling skills or simply enjoy the peaceful surroundings. The fact that admission is free makes this a low-pressure start, and some reviews note that the guide was friendly and helpful during this segment.

Second Stop: Coconut Island & Ocean World

By 9:00 am, you’re off to Coconut Island, part of the An Thoi archipelago. Here, the highlight is a visit to Ocean World, a sea sports center where you can indulge in activities like banana floats, jet skiing, and exploring the coral park—at your own expense. The 1.5-hour stay offers enough time to relax, snap photos of the stunning scenery, and even try a few water sports if you’re feeling adventurous. Visitors mention that the views here are especially photogenic, with clear waters and lush greenery.

Third Stop: Gam Ghi Island for Snorkeling

At around 11:30 am, it’s time for snorkeling at Gam Ghi Island. This part of the trip seems to be the most highly praised, with many noting the crystal-clear waters and vibrant marine life. The snorkeling gear (mask, snorkel, life jacket) is provided, and the experience allows you to see colorful fish and coral. One guest mentioned, “The water was so clear I could see everything even without diving deep,” highlighting how accessible and enjoyable the snorkeling is, even for beginners.

Lunch on the Boat

By 12:30 pm, everyone reconvenes for a lunch served on the boat. While simple, many reviews appreciate the convenience of having a meal included, allowing more time to enjoy the scenery rather than searching for restaurants. The lunch generally includes local flavors, and vegetarian or special dietary requests can be accommodated if notified in advance.

Fourth Stop: May Rut Island

After lunch, you visit May Rut Trong Islet around 3:00 pm. It’s a fantastic spot for leisurely sea bathing, relaxing on the sand, or just soaking in the views. The shallow waters make it safe for swimming and wading, and the peaceful atmosphere is perfect for unwinding. Some travelers mention it’s the best spot for just chilling out after a busy morning of activities.

Final Stop: Thom Islet & the Cable Car

The highlight towards the end of the day is a visit to Thom Islet, where you can ride the world’s longest sea-crossing cable car. This part of the tour offers breathtaking panoramic perspectives of the island, ocean, and surrounding islands. From the reviews, the cable car ride is often described as the “ultimate photo opportunity,” with many capturing stunning shots of the shimmering water below. The viewing platform at Thom Islet also provides a chance to stretch and take in the scenery.

Return to Your Hotel

By 5:00 pm, the boat trip ends, and you are transported back to your hotel, ending a packed but rewarding day of island exploration.

What Travelers Need to Know: The Practical Side

Discover 2 Islands of Phu Quoc by boat - What Travelers Need to Know: The Practical Side

Transportation & Group Size

The round-trip shuttle makes the logistics straightforward, especially if you’re staying along Tran Hung Dao street. The tour limits group size to 15 travelers, which generally results in more personalized attention from guides like Minh or Lan—both of whom guests say are friendly and informative.

Duration & Pacing

Spanning roughly 6 to 7 hours, the tour balances diverse activities with manageable pacing. Travelers should be prepared for a full day, with some stops being more leisurely while others, like snorkeling, are more active. The schedule is tight but designed to give a taste of each location’s highlights.

Price & Value

At $80 per person, the cost includes transfers, lunch, snorkeling gear, and access to several islands. Considering the variety of experiences packed into one day, many find it offers good value—especially when compared to the expense of booking individual activities or transportation.

What’s Not Included

Tips and additional expenses like water sports at Ocean World or souvenirs are not included. It’s wise to bring some extra cash if you want to rent jet skis or purchase refreshments.

Weather & Cancellation Policy

Since this tour relies on good weather, cancellations due to poor weather are possible, but you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und. The tour has a minimum number of travelers, so it could be canceled if not enough people sign up, but this is rare.
